Minor Earthquake Shakes Los Angeles: Residents Report Rattling

Los Angeles, CA (October 26, 2023) – A minor earthquake rattled Los Angeles this morning, sending residents scrambling and prompting a flurry of activity on social media. The quake, which struck at approximately 7:15 AM PST, registered a preliminary magnitude of 3.8 on the Richter scale, according to the United States Geological Survey (USGS). While relatively small, the tremor was widely felt across the city, causing brief moments of alarm and prompting many to share their experiences online.

Tremors Felt Across the City

The USGS reports the epicenter was located approximately 5 miles northwest of downtown Los Angeles, at a relatively shallow depth. This proximity to the densely populated urban core explains why the earthquake was felt so extensively. Residents from Hollywood to Beverly Hills reported feeling a noticeable shaking, described by many as a brief but sharp jolt. Social media platforms were quickly flooded with posts using hashtags like #LAearthquake and #earthquakesocal, with users sharing their accounts of the event.

"I was just making coffee when the whole apartment started shaking," tweeted one resident. "It only lasted a few seconds, but it was definitely enough to get my heart racing!" Another user commented, "My dog started barking like crazy! That's usually my first sign that something's up."

While the shaking was brief, the experience was enough to remind Angelenos of the region's seismic activity. Southern California sits atop several major fault lines, making earthquakes, both large and small, a regular occurrence.

No Significant Damage Reported

Fortunately, initial reports suggest no significant damage or injuries resulted from the earthquake. Emergency services have not reported any major incidents related to the tremor. However, authorities are still assessing the situation and encouraging residents to report any damage or injuries.

This minor earthquake serves as a timely reminder of the importance of earthquake preparedness. Living in a seismically active region necessitates having an emergency plan in place, including storing essential supplies and knowing evacuation routes.

Earthquake Preparedness Tips

  • Create an emergency kit: Include water, non-perishable food, a first-aid kit, a flashlight, and a battery-powered radio.
  • Develop an evacuation plan: Identify safe zones in your home and establish a meeting point for family members.
  • Secure your home: Bolt heavy furniture to walls and secure water heaters.
  • Learn CPR and first aid: Basic emergency response skills can be invaluable in the aftermath of a disaster.
  • Stay informed: Monitor news and emergency alerts for updates and instructions.
